#e26066 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e26066 is composed of 88.6% red, 37.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#e26066 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0cc with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e26066 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e26066 has RGB values of R:226, G:96,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14835814.

Shades and Tints of #e26066
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070102 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e26066
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89a9b is the less saturated color, while #ff434c is the most saturated one.
